When is the 'National Girl Child Day' celebrated?

A.

January 24

B.

November 14

C.

March 8

D.

November 19

Correct option is A

The correct answer is: (a) January 24

Explanation:

  • National Girl Child Day is celebrated annually on January 24 in India.

  • The day was initiated in 2008 by the Ministry of Women and Child Development to raise awareness about the challenges faced by girls in Indian society.

  • The observance aims to promote gender equality, highlight issues such as child marriage, female foeticide, and the importance of education and nutrition for girls.

  • Various programs, including rallies, workshops, and cultural events, are organized across the country to celebrate the day and advocate for the rights of the girl child.

Information Booster:

  • Initiation Year: 2008

  • Organized by:Ministry of Women and Child Development, Government of India

  • Key Objectives:

    • Raise awareness about gender-based discrimination and its impact on girls.

    • Promote the importance of education, health, and nutrition for girls.

    • Advocate for the elimination of child marriage and female foeticide.

    • Encourage the empowerment of girls through various initiatives.

  • Significance:Serves as a reminder to society about the value of girls and the significance of providing them with equal opportunities.

Additional Information:

  •  November 14:Celebrated as Children's Day in India, marking the birth anniversary of Jawaharlal Nehru.

  • March 8:Observed as International Women's Day, focusing on women's rights and gender equality globally.

  •  November 19:Celebrated as International Men's Day, highlighting the positive value men bring to the world.
